These earrings feature marbled wedding beads, abundant garnets, moss agate, and ethnic bells.
The wedding beads, also known as lightbulb or teardrop beads, are from the early 20th century.
As they are antique, there are minor scratches, but please enjoy the charm of these imperfections.
The wedding beads have a chic, slim silhouette with a white and purple marble pattern.
(Wedding bead size: 1.6cm length, 0.7cm width)
Cut garnets are clustered like ripe fruit.
The green stone beads are moss agate.
The small, antique-colored bells are components from the Kuchi tribe of Afghanistan, originally part of decorative items and also antique.
They do not chime.
These earrings blend a sophisticated color palette with unique antique parts.
